Saraland, AL vs Vestavia Hills, AL
The cost of living difference between Saraland, AL and Vestavia Hills, AL is dramatic. Saraland is 30.8% cheaper than Vestavia Hills,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Saraland has a cost index of 81 while Vestavia Hills sits at 117,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Saraland is $1,071/month compared to $1,455/month in Vestavia Hills — a 26%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Saraland is more affordable at $210,500 median vs $494,500.
Median household income in Saraland is $60,577 compared to $129,171 in Vestavia Hills (-53.1%). While Vestavia Hills is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Saraland spend roughly 21.2% of their income on rent, more than the 13.5% in Vestavia Hills.
Climate-wise, Saraland is notably warmer with an average of 67.6°F compared to 63.9°F in Vestavia Hills. Saraland receives more rainfall at 67.1" per year compared to 56.6" in Vestavia Hills.
